摘要
The transformation of 12 radioactively labeled compounds into 2,5-dimethyl-4-hydroxy-3(2H)-furanone (DMHF), glycosidically bound DMHF, and 2,5-dimethyl-4-methoxy-3(2H)-furanone (DMMF) was investigated in detached ripening strawberry fruits (Fragaria x ananassa) over a 3-day period. Radiochemical analysis of the different fruit parts revealed that major portions of the applied radioactivity (up to 66%) remained in the stems and calyx. Incorporation levels of [2-C-14]dihydroxyacetone, D-[1-H-3]glucose, D-[U-C-14]-glucose, D-[U-C-14]glucose 6-phosphate, D-[U-C-14]fructose, and D-[U-C-14]fructose 1,6-bisphosphate into the total amount of furanone derivatives were 0.022, 0.032, 0.035, 0.147, 0.202, and 0.289% of the radioactivity entering the fruits, respectively. Minor amounts of radioactivity (<0.001%) were detected in the furanone structures after the administration of [1-C-14]acetate and [3-C-14]pyruvate. L-[1-C-14]Fucose, L-[6-H-3]fucose, L-[1-H-3]rhamnose, L-[U-C-14]threonine, L-[U-C-14]lactaldehyde, and [2-C-14]malonic acid were not transformed into DMHF or a derivative thereof.
